Minutes — Management Meeting, Support Outsourcing

For the board. Decision: approve outsourcing tier-1 support for the Harlowe product line to the Dravelin vendor. Cost savings estimated at 22% annually. Transition window: six months. Risks: knowledge loss, CSAT dip during ramp. Mitigation plan approved. Severance provisions finalized. The confidential note on dependent business plans is set out below.

internal memo for hahaf-kahof: Only 39 of the 428 pilot accounts renewed Sorion, so a churn review is set for April 12. Praokix Freight is in early talks to buy Queniusox Group for about $145.8 million.

**Mgmt Meeting Minutes — Retiring the Brightline Range**

Quick recap for sales leads at Fenholt Supplies: we agreed to retire the Brightline fixture range by year-end. Remaining stock moves to clearance pricing next month, and accounts on standing orders get migrated to the Lumetta range. Trade-in incentives were approved in principle. The confidential note on next steps sits just below.

board note of bajof-bajeg: The pricing group signed off on a budget of $13.4 million for Project Sildor. The renewal with Lamixek Holdings closes at $48.9 million a year, 49 percent above the last contract.

## Tidewatch Widget: Limits & Quotas

The Tidewatch widget fetches tide predictions from the Marloch forecast service, which enforces per-tenant rate limits. Exceeding them returns cached data, not errors, so failures are easy to miss. New team members should not change these values without a load test. The current tuning constants are as follows:

tuning table, yajog-yahof:
BUDGETS = {
    "lamvan": 303,
    "wenox": 460,
    "fenvan": 525,
}

Ticket: BranchReaper misconfigured in staging. Flagging for the weekly sync — BranchReaper has been silently skipping its cleanup pass since Tuesday because staging's env file was copied from the sandbox template. The bot starts, lists stale branches, then fails the delete call and exits zero, so no alerts fired. Fix is straightforward: the repo-write credential was never set. In .env.staging, directly below REAPER_DRY_RUN=false, add this line:

secret setting of yaweg-hahig: COURIER_KEY5=39d45